OS/2 isn't dead: ArcaOS update brings the 1980s-era OS to modern UEFI PCs

Summary by Tech Spot
A quarter of a century after IBM released the last official version of OS/2, someone is still keeping the platform alive under the ArcaOS name. Arca Noae is now the only company licensing OS/2 technology from IBM, after Serenity Systems' eComStation project disappeared around 14 years ago.Read Entire Article
